Hi, I'm interested in getting a Baader steeltrack with steeldrive motorised system for my Skywatcher 200p but is it true that the setup is only suitable for refractors and SCT. If so, how come it won't fit a Newt? And if it can, would I really need a hand controller as I'd only need it for imaging?

If there are any other owners of the 200p that have auto focus, what setup do you have?

All help is greatly appreciated.

Hi Phil,

There is Diamond SteelTrack for Newtonians available....I have one installed on my Quattro, and it's a great step up from the stock Skywatcher focuser. https://www.firstlightoptics.com/baader-diamond-steeltrack-focusers/baader-steeltrack-diamond-nt-for-newtonians.html

The autofocuser (SteelDrive) for this is currently unavailable however! I've been waiting for some while for the newly designed replacement to become available, which (according to Mr Baader himself....)should be pretty soon, though if it doesn't materialise soon I may well opt for the Sesto Senso...which is looking good..https://www.primalucelab.com/astronomy/sesto-senso-robotic-focusing-motor.html

I have the Baader focuser on my Orion 8" newt and have fitted a DIY arduino ascom focuser with it and have had no issues.  I did want to get the Baader one but 1-it was withdrawn and 2-I could not justify the cost of it when I could build one for £35 or there about and it does the same thing.
